Totally fucking useless, I'd remove them or use disavow before you get penalised.
I've posted about fiverr links before, as have others, they are great if you wanna send some negative seo to someone, but thats about it.
http://www.linkspun.com/forum/viewtopic.php?f=10&t=1562

Most of them links are forum profiles, not good, and to make things worse they have the same text so they just look like duplicate pages, a huge no no.
You should only use links like that to strengthen tier one links, not direct to your money site.
You might get away with it cos most of them links will never get indexed but I'd use disavow just to be safe.
Download this link checker and add the live links to disavow http://www.blackhatlinks.com/blackhatli ... hecker.php
And don't use that site for links also, just as bad as fiverr.

If you must use fiverr ask the seller to provide account info for the sites before you buy so you can remove the links yourself if it all goes to shit.

yeah, it was a waste of money but imho if you dont disavow those links you will loose more than just money. Google "penguin" algo will definitely mark your site for suspicious backlinks - unnatural backlink profile. And lets be honest it is an unnatural backlink profile - unrelated to your site plus they came out of nowhere all out of a sudden. If I were you I would immediately disavow them. I mean only if Google traffic is dear to you... bottom line as always: shortcuts do not work
